Kyiv resident Yuri Popovich almost lost his entire family’s savings due to the sharp fall in the price of UST. Terra’s fiasco has brought terrible consequences to many investors around the world. It is reported that one of them is Yuri Popovich, a Ukrainian citizen. He invested about $10000 (all his family savings) in the stablecoin UST, and almost lost everything.

UST and a Ukrainian Family

In times of financial turmoil and negative events (such as Russia’s invasion of Ukraine), cryptocurrency and stablecoin can be used as an investment tool. In any case, allocating some wealth to asset classes sounds like a better ratio than buying property in war-torn areas.

Relying on this assumption, Kyiv residents – Yuri Popovich – invested all his family funds (nearly 10000 US dollars) into UST (a stablecoin, which sounds less risky than most cryptocurrencies with large fluctuations on paper, because it should be 1:1 linked to the US dollar). “I am not a speculator; I just want to save money,” the man said.

However, at the beginning of this month, the asset lost its peg to the national currency of the United States and is currently hovering at only $0.06. Popovich revealed that due to the collapse, his investment melted to $500.

This devastating loss also brought serious health problems to this person. “I no longer sleep normally and lose 4kg; I often have headache and anxiety. My wife still doesn’t know this loss. I don’t know how to tell her.”.

Popovich pointed out that the current living conditions in Ukraine are extremely difficult. That said, the collapse of UST and the “huge amount” of the family will make their lives more challenging.
“This is a huge sum of money for us. In the current situation, it is crucial to life. I am worried about my wife’s health, my health, and our relationship. I don’t even know how it will end.”

Other Investors Hurt By Luna/UST Crash

As reported earlier this month, an unidentified person rang the doorbell of do Kwon (CEO of terrain labs). It is said that the man came to the executive, but only his wife was there.

According to another report, the intruder was an investor of Luna, who lost $2.3 million due to the bloodbath of the market. He explained to law enforcement officials in South Korea that many investors committed suicide because of catastrophic losses and asked Quan Jian to be responsible for these deaths.

Another person who lost millions by investing in Luna is British pop YouTuber and rapper JJ Olatunji, or Ksi. The latter is also an enthusiast of bitcoin. He disclosed that he distributed about $2.8 million of wealth to the original token of Tara, and his investment is now worth less than $500.
